Vodafone Idea names Gopika Pant to board for five-year term
Pant will have a five-year tenure beginning September 17, 2026

Vodafone Idea has inducted legal expert Gopika Pant onto its board as an Additional Director and Independent Woman Director for a five-year tenure beginning September 17, 2026. The board cleared her appointment on September 14, which now requires shareholder approval.
Pant, who has over four decades of experience in the legal field, founded Indian Law Partners. She is qualified to practise in India and is also admitted to the New York Bar. Her areas of expertise include corporate and commercial law, cross-border transactions, mergers and acquisitions, and corporate restructuring.
The telecom company is also seeking shareholders’ nod for the appointment of Anil Berera as an Independent Director. Berera joined the board for a five-year term with effect from August 31, 2026.
Vodafone Idea has initiated a postal ballot to secure shareholder approval for both appointments.
